JAVA编程里边如何开立方

JAVA编程里边如何开立方

作者:William Gu发布时间:2026-02-27阅读时长:0 分钟阅读次数:7

用户关注问题

Q
如何在Java中计算一个数的立方?

我想在Java程序中计算一个数字的立方,应该使用什么方法或者函数?

A

使用Math.pow函数计算立方

在Java中,可以使用Math.pow(base, exponent)函数来计算立方。例如,Math.pow(数值, 3)即可计算该数值的三次方。

Q
计算立方时是否有更高效的替代方案?

使用Math.pow计算立方会不会比较慢?有没有性能更好的写法?

A

直接乘法运算替代Math.pow提高性能

计算立方可以用数值 * 数值 * 数值来代替Math.pow(数值, 3),减少函数调用开销,提升性能。

Q
Java中如何处理浮点数的立方计算?

我有一个double类型的数,想计算立方,需注意哪些问题?

A

使用double类型变量和Math.pow或乘法计算立方

可以直接对double类型变量使用Math.pow(value, 3)或者value * value * value计算立方,结果依然是double类型。注意浮点数的计算可能存在舍入误差。